I'm in the crash and burn phase. Being a caterer, Derby is my second busiest season of the year. In the last 96 hours, I worked 81. I'm a little delirious!

 

This is always such an exciting time of year. There's about 3 weeks of festivites leading up to the actual race. When it's over, teh whole city is kind of in a coma, stumbling around trying to re-group and make plans for the next year.

 

It would have been so much better had the race not had such a tragic end. The place horse (2nd) fell and broke both front ankles and had to be put down on the track after she crossed the finish line. I cried when I heard it on the radio (I wasn't at a TV to watch). We've had a lot of high-profile losses in the last few years with Barbaro, Breeders Cup, and now this.
